Milk & Black Tea Kanten
"Kanten (agar)" is a popular ingredient for Wagashi, especially in summer. It looks like jelly but it's made from seaweeds. So it isn't necessary to worry about a protease and we can put any fresh fruits in it! It gets glass like transparency but with a lot of sugar.
I made a check pattern Wagashi with less sugar Kanten blocks of milk and sweet ones of Earl Grey (black tea). It's lovely marriage!

①Put the 150ml of water in a saucepan. ②Add 2g of agar. ③Mix them. Heat it up on a medium flame to boiling. ④Turn down the flame when it boils. Simmer it for 2minuites.
- 4
①Add 10g of sugar. ②Mix them on medium flame. ③Add 50ml of milk when the sugar and mix them. ④Turn off the flame.
- 5
①Pour the liquid into a mold. ②Remove bubbles. Leave it until it gets hard. ③Cut and divide it into 4×4. ④Lay a sheet of plastic wrap. Put the half of them on the sheet. Leave another half in the mold. Arrange each half in a grid pattern.
- 6
①Put the 200ml of tea in a saucepan. ②Add 2g of agar. ③Mix them. Heat it up on a medium flame to boiling. ④Turn down the flame when it boils. Simmer it for 2minuites.
- 7
①Add 100g of granulated sugar. ② Mix them on medium flame. ③Turn down the flame and simmer it for 1minuite. ④Skim off the scum and turn off the flame.
- 8
①Pour the tea Kanten liquid into a mold to a little blow from the top of Milk kanten blocks. Leave it until it getting hard. (But do not wait that it becomes hard completely.) ②Put the another half of milk Kanten blocks on the tea kantan. ③Pour the tea kanten liquid into a mold to the same level of the milk kanten blocks. ④Leave it until it getting hard. *But do not wait that it becomes hard completely.
- 9
①Put fan shaped kiwifruits. ②Pour the tea Kanten liquid until it covers the kiwifruits. ③Leave it until it gets hard completely. ④Unmold and cut it. It's to be served and eaten cold !
